- exobuzz - 2011-08-18

not here. full log on pastebin or similar. but actually it's not needed now, as I have tested myself. I am aware of this issue. right now, it points to something not working right with the nightly python on windows (ive reproduced it on windows 7 / 64bit)


- exobuzz - 2011-08-18

I have tracked down the issue. it occurs when you have Dharma installed and then you install the new version over the top. You need to uninstall first and it should be fine. Ill report this to xbmc anyway, as they could handle this better in the installer.

this would also explain why I never found the problem in the past, as I tested with a clean install. it probably also explains why some people reported nightlies worked and others reported it didn't. so always uninstall first before installing a new version. (else you get a mess/mismatching python library files)
